20th in meters gained at 435 m per game, 5.5 score involvements per game, 4.5 inside 50s per game. When it comes to being an outside midfielder, Atkins is well and truly doing what we're paying him for offensively.

Unfortunately, he's a classic outside midfielder in flaws as well as strengths hence why we're here and your bamboozled as to why he's still selected, because him getting brushed aside every time he tackles is very much a who cares thing. We're not playing him because he's a defensive behemoth, we're paying him to supplement our outside game.

Count how many times he turns it over on saturday night.. also count how many times he runs both ways and along with that how many times he squibs it.

An outside midfielder who isn't turning the ball over at a higher rate then most positions isn't doing his job properly. Atkins is expected to take risks with his disposals and go for options most would get told off for going for, much like Smith and Seedsman are. It's a necessary evil of the position.

Oh boy, you'll be in for a surprise when you see Atkins heat maps. He does a lot of hard running defensively, and squibs it is really also firmly in the bucket of "outside midfielder" problems. We're not paying for toughness here at all. We're paying for offensive production, and as the numbers I gave earlier indicated, we're getting a bit out of him.

You give me the choice between Atkins who does all of the things I want offensively in a lowly ranked outside option, yet can be exposed in a contest, or someone like Mackay who is brave in the contest, yet does not do all of the things offensively I want in an lowly ranked outside option, and I'm choosing Atkins every single time. Every coach in this league also chooses Atkins every single time.
